Enhancing Agile Efficiency: A Comprehensive Guide to Scrum Resource Allocation Tools
The dynamic digital environment demands the adoption of efficient frameworks for optimal project management. One such framework, Scrum, is widely valued for its ability to manage complex software development tasks. Vital to its success is effective resource allocation, which ensures team members are optimally utilized and projects stay on track. In recent times, Scrum resource allocation tools have emerged as indispensable aids. Let's delve deep into understanding these tools, their benefits, and best practices for their implementation.
Understanding Scrum Resource Allocation Tools
Scrum resource allocation tools are sophisticated platforms designed to enhance the agile project management process. These tools focus on optimizing the distribution and utilization of resources within Scrum teams. By providing a clear overview of team members' availability, skills, and current project involvement, these tools enable team leaders to allocate tasks efficiently. Effective allocation is crucial in minimizing work overload and ensuring deadlines are met without compromising quality.
The primary advantage of using these tools is their ability to streamline communication and collaboration. With centralized dashboards, stakeholders can quickly assess resource availability, reduce bottlenecks, and make informed decisions. The tools also come equipped with reporting capabilities that offer insights into productivity and potential areas of improvement.
Automation plays a significant role in improving the accuracy and reliability of these tools. Automated reminders, updates, and notifications ensure that no task slips through the cracks. Furthermore, these tools support agile methodologies by fostering continuous feedback and adaptation, allowing teams to respond swiftly to changing project demands.
Benefits of Using Scrum Resource Allocation Tools
Incorporating Scrum resource allocation tools can lead to a multitude of benefits, significantly enhancing project outcomes. One primary benefit is increased visibility across all project dimensions. By providing a bird's-eye view of the project timeline, resource allocation tools enable better strategic planning and prevent resource conflicts. The transparency afforded by these tools ensures that all team members are on the same page, which is essential for agile frameworks that thrive on collaboration.
Moreover, these tools can improve team productivity by ensuring an even distribution of workload. Avoiding burnout and maintaining high morale among team members is crucial for achieving project goals. With real-time data, managers can make proactive decisions to redistribute tasks, ensuring that all team members are used to their full potential without being overburdened.
Resource allocation tools also support more accurate project forecasts. By analyzing past project data, these tools can help predict the time and resources required for future tasks. This foresight aids in better budgeting and time management, leading to a higher likelihood of project success.
Best Practices for Implementing Resource Allocation Tools
Successfully implementing Scrum resource allocation tools involves more than just purchasing and installing new software. It requires a strategic approach to integrating these tools into existing workflows while ensuring team buy-in and participation. Start by aligning the tool with your team's specific needs and workflows. Each team is unique, and the tool should reflect and support the current operational model without imposing rigid structures.
Training is another critical component. Team members should be comfortable using the tool and versed in its functionalities. Conduct initial training sessions and provide ongoing support to help your team fully leverage the tool's capabilities.
Continuous evaluation and adaptation are key. Regularly assess the tool's effectiveness and its impact on team productivity and project outcomes. Solicit feedback and be open to making adjustments based on team interactions. Remember, the goal is to enhance agility and efficiency—not hinder or complicate processes.
Finally, establish clear guidelines and processes for updating and managing the tool's data. Accurate data is essential for effective resource allocation, so prioritize maintaining the integrity of the information within the tool. Encourage team members to regularly update their progress and any challenges they encounter, ensuring that the tool reflects real-time project status.
By understanding and implementing these strategies, you can turn Scrum resource allocation tools into a powerhouse for agile project management, facilitating better resource management and leading to successful project outcomes. Whether you are a seasoned Scrum professional or new to agile methodologies, integrating these tools can significantly elevate your project management capabilities.